About

In recent decades, authors affiliated with Instituto Nacional de Cancerología have published 1.2k papers, which have received a total of 17.9k ind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 371 papers in Oncology, 298 papers in Surgery and 272 papers in Epidemiology on the topics of Cervical Cancer and HPV Research (160 papers), Global Cancer Incidence and Screening (85 papers) and Endometrial and Cervical Cancer Treatments (80 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Epidemiology (8.4k citations), Surgery (5.3k citations) and Oncology (4.5k citations). Authors at Instituto Nacional de Cancerología collaborate with scholars in Colombia, United States and Mexico and have published in prestigious journals including New England Journal of Medicine, The Lancet and Journal of Clinical Oncology. Some of Instituto Nacional de Cancerología's most productive authors include Núbia Muñóz, Rolando Herrero, Raúl Murillo, Silvia Franceschi and Marion Piñeros.
